Overall, the hostel facilities at IIM Sambalpur were satisfactory. The rooms had basic amenities such as a bed, almirah, and study table and chair setup. The quality of the food served in the mess was average, with a diverse menu that changed monthly based on student preferences. One downside was that the hostel fees, which were included in the overall cost of the program, were somewhat expensive at 13 lakhs for two years. However, the hostel did provide useful facilities like a water filter and washing machine on each floor. Overall, the hostel experience at IIM Sambalpur was fairly typical for a business school program.
Life at the IIM Sambalpur campus is hectic but never mundane. With rigorous classes and assignments, students often find themselves burning the midnight oil in the library. However, there is also a strong focus on extracurricular activities, with numerous student committees and clubs, such as the Cultural and Sports Committee, providing opportunities for students to relax and socialize. The annual fest, Ethos, is a two-day event featuring a variety of management, cultural, and sports activities. The campus is also home to a well-stocked library with a wide range of books and journals available for students. Classrooms are equipped with modern amenities, and there are numerous sports and extracurricular activities for students to get involved in. The campus is also home to a number of social groups and clubs, such as the PR and Media Committee, which students run.
